No professional driving experience is required.
To get started, you must meet the minimum age to drive in your city and possess at least one year of licensed driving experience in the US (three years if under 25). You will need a valid US driver's license, proof of residency, and an eligible 4-door vehicle. All drivers must consent to a background check and have an iPhone or Android smartphone. Specific vehicle requirements vary by region and will be displayed during the application process.
Stated earnings figures are based on median earnings of drivers in specific locations over defined periods. Actual earnings vary depending on factors such as the number of trips completed, time of day, and location. Earnings include trip fares, certain promotions, and tips. Drivers are paid based on completed trips rather than an hourly rate.
